Children from Peel Park Primary School and residents at Anchor - Ashcroft care home exchanged stories of growing up in different eras during a recent visit.

The visit from Peel Park Primary School was made possible by The Linking Network and its Intergenerational Linking programme. The programme brings together young people in schools with older people living in care homes, independent living or from community groups.

The team at Anchor - Berkeley Court care home Leeds have been celebrating after being classed as ‘good’ by the Care Quality Commission (CQC), the second highest rating possible.

The CQC’s robust inspection process gives care homes a rating of outstanding, good, requires improvement, or inadequate based on five categories. Berkeley Court care home was rated good in the three categories inspected.

The CQC inspectors were impressed by colleagues at Berkeley Court respecting people’s preferences and choices and encouraging independence. Inspectors noted that Anchor colleagues were kind and respectful and ensured that people had access to the care and support they required.

Well done to the team at Overstone House who recently completed a challenging 26-mile walk in support of Alzheimer's Society, raising £4435 for the vital cause.

The walk marks just one of several community initiatives at Overstone House. The team's fundraising efforts continue with another event in August - a local community dog show and funday where all monies raised will go to Veterans with Dogs, a charity that supplies therapy dogs to veterans.
